How to fill out the Home-Educated College Preparatory Credit Evaluation - Middlesex online
This guide provides a comprehensive overview of filling out the Home-Educated College Preparatory Credit Evaluation form for Middlesex Community College. Whether you are new to the process or seeking clarification, these detailed steps will assist you in completing each section accurately.
Follow the steps to successfully complete your credit evaluation form.
- Click ‘Get Form’ button to obtain the form and open it in your preferred document editor.
- Begin by entering the student's name in the designated field. This is essential for proper identification.
- Provide the student's Social Security number and expected graduation date. Ensure these details are accurate as they are important for processing.
- Complete the worksheet by indicating any course that completes less than one academic year of study. You may need to use additional sheets for listing completed subjects or providing further explanations. Common supplementary information includes reading lists and major projects.
- List completed courses under each subject area provided in the form. Include details like subject title, year completed, and grade for every course. For instance, ensure English courses meet the requirement of 4 units with options like Grammar and Usage, American English, etc.
- Continue filling in the math section, ensuring you include 3.5 units of Math and 0.5 unit of Computer. Choose appropriate courses such as Algebra I or Geometry.
- For the Natural Science section, select courses that add up to at least 2 units, confirming that Biology with Lab is required.
- In the Social Studies section, list the required courses U.S. History I and U.S. History II, plus any additional social studies applicable.
- Document your foreign language courses, ensuring you account for 2 units. Fill in both the first and second years if applicable.
- Fill in the Vocational Education/Arts and Physical Education sections, including course titles, if applicable.
- For the Health section, note any health-related courses or content studied.
- List your academic electives until you reach the required total of 6.5 units. This may include a variety of courses.
- Once all sections are complete, review your entries for accuracy. After finalizing, save or download your completed form for submission.
- Lastly, print or share the form as needed and attach it to your completed Middlesex Community College Application for Admission.
